Framed 16x12 Print, Black Grain Bevel with White Mount. , Toxoplasmosis. False colour transmission electron micrograph of the trophozoite, or proliferative form, of the sporozoan Toxoplasma gondii. Several organisms (large central ovals) are seen in liver tissue. T. gondii causes toxoplasmosis in humans and is especially dangerous to pregnant women. Cats are the definitive host and all mammals including sheep and cattle may become infected.
